ACCUMULATION DANCE

 

Choreographers and dancers Laura Chevalier, Meghan McLyman, and Kristen Duffy Young began rehearsing together in 2006 and officially formed Accumulation Dance in 2008. They hosted their premier performance, Accumulation, on November 7th and 8th, 2008 at Green Street Studios in Cambridge, MA. As proponents of collaboration, they reached out to talented artists Julie Pike Edmond/Turnpike Project, Callie Chapman Korn/Zoe Dance, and Bess Whitesel and Carrie Foster to share in this performance.

Since their premiere, Accumulation Dance has performed at the 2009 Volvo Ocean Race at Fan Pier, Boston, the Salem Arts Festival in Salem, MA, Dance for World Community Day at Jose Mateo's Ballet Theatre, Cambridge, MA, and the Dance Complex, Cambridge, MA.

Prior to the formation of Accumulation Dance, the choreographers presented their work throughout the Boston area, Washington, D.C., and Virginia, in such venues as Ten’s the Limit, Green Street Studios Emerging Artist and Performance Works Projects, Art Beat and Somerville Struts at the Somerville Theater, Salem State College, College of the Holy Cross, Roxbury Community College, Massachusetts College of Art and Design, James Madison University, The Joy of Motion (D.C.), and more.
